Ankleshwar: The Industrial Powerhouse

Ankleshwar is a bustling industrial town with a major focus on chemicals, pharmaceuticals, and textiles. Home to over 1,200 large-scale industries, it has become one of the largest industrial hubs in India. The Ankleshwar GIDC (Gujarat Industrial Development Corporation) provides cutting-edge infrastructure, fostering a conducive environment for both local and international businesses. The town’s highly skilled labor force and abundant resources make it an attractive destination for industries, from chemicals to engineering.

Dhahej: A Strategic Port Town

Dhahej, located on the banks of the Gulf of Khambhat, is a vital port town known for its maritime trade. The Dhahej SEZ (Special Economic Zone) is home to industries such as logistics, manufacturing, petrochemicals, and more. The location's strategic proximity to the sea offers unparalleled trade and transportation advantages, making it a prime destination for global commerce.

Ongoing infrastructure developments, including the expansion of port facilities, promise to further elevate Dhahej's standing as a leading industrial and logistical center in Gujarat. Travel Facilities and Connectivity

Getting around the industrial hub is convenient thanks to excellent transport facilities:

  • By Road: Ankleshwar, Dhahej, Bharuch, and Jagadia are well-connected by National Highway 48, making travel between the towns smooth and efficient.

  • By Rail: Bharuch Railway Station offers strong connectivity to major cities, ensuring that industrial travelers can easily access the region by train.

  • By Air: Surat Airport, located approximately 65 km from Ankleshwar, offers domestic flights to key cities across India, providing easy air access to industrial visitors.

Local transport options, including taxis, auto-rickshaws, and buses, are available to navigate between towns and the industrial zones.

  Downward-Facing Dog pose, which is a common yoga posture. In Sanskrit, it's called Adho Mukha Svanasana . Here's how to do it: Start on all fours : Begin in a tabletop position with your hands directly under your shoulders and knees under your hips. Lift your hips : Slowly raise your hips toward the ceiling, aiming to form an inverted "V" shape with your body. Your feet should be hip-width apart, and your hands should be shoulder-width apart. Straighten your legs : Keep a slight bend in your knees if your hamstrings are tight, but aim to straighten your legs as much as possible. Press your heels toward the floor : Try to press your heels gently toward the mat, but don’t worry if they don’t reach the floor—just focus on lengthening your spine. Engage your core and arms : Keep your core engaged and arms extended, pressing the palms into the floor and pushing your chest back toward your thighs.
